ubuntu怎么安装opencv
安装工具
sudo apt-get install git
sudo apt-get install g++
sudo apt-get install vim123
下载Opencv
opencv2.9
解压
mkdir tmp
mv opencv-2.4.9.zip tmp
cd tmp
unzip opencv-2.4.9.zip
cd opencv-2.4.9
mkdir release123456
安装依赖库
sudo apt-get install build-essential cmake libgtk2.0-dev pkg-config python-dev python-numpy libavcodec-dev libavformat-dev libswscale-dev 1
在opencv的官方文档也有说明:
GCC 4.4.x or later. This can be installed with:sudo apt-get install build-essential
CMake 2.6 or higher;
Git;
GTK+2.x or higher, including headers (libgtk2.0-dev);
pkg-config;
Python 2.6 or later and Numpy 1.5 or later with developer packages (python-dev, python-numpy);
ffmpeg or libav development packages: libavcodec-dev, libavformat-dev, libswscale-dev;
[optional] libdc1394 2.x;
[optional] libjpeg-dev, libpng-dev, libtiff-dev, libjasper-dev.
ff-dev, libjasper-dev.
进入目录生成MakeFile文件
cd releaase1
安装所有的lib文件都会被安装到/usr/local目录下
cmake -D CMAKE_BUILD_TYPE=RELEASE -D CMAKE_INSTALL_PREFIX=/usr/local ..1
构建和安装
make1
make install1
加载动态连接库
sudo sh -c 'echo "/usr/local/lib" /etc/ld.so.conf.d/opencv.conf'
sudo ldconfig
怎么在ubuntu上安装opencv
OpenCV 2.2以后版本需要使用Cmake生成makefile文件,因此需要先安装cmake。
ubuntu下安装cmake比较简单,
apt-get install cmake
apt-get install libgtk2.0-dev(下面两步安装编译必须的库)
apt-get install pkg-config
然后你们下载openc-2.4.3 然后 解压
然后cmake-gui 进入了 ui配置界面 在路劲那里配置好你的opencv位置 和 安装路径
然后点 configure 然后选中 unix makefiles 然后选 use xxxxxx compilter
这跟命令行配置 cmake -D CMAKE_BUILD_TYPE=RELEASE CMAKE_INSTALL_PREFIX=/home/OpenCV 是一样的
之后就是安装了 make 然后make install
然后是配置变量
sudo gedit /etc/ld.so.conf.d/opencv.conf
最后一行增添 /usr/local/lib
然后是跟改变量
sudo gedit /etc/bash.bashrc
也是在最后一行添加
PKG_CONFIG_PATH=$PKG_CONFIG_PATH:/usr/local/lib/pkgconfig
export PKG_CONFIG_PATH
码字辛苦 请给满意答案
在ubuntu16.04上怎么用anaconda安装opencv
1、根据系统也Python版本选择对应的安装包。
2.进入下载目录,打开终端,根据版本输入安装命令:
python 3.6 version
bash Anaconda3-4.3.1-Linux-x86_64.sh
Python 2.7 version
bash Anaconda2-4.3.1-Linux-x86_64.sh
3.安装过程,一直回车即可,当遇到下面的选择,注意输入yes:
Do you wish the installer to prepend the Anaconda2 install location
to PATH in your /home/gjq/.bashrc ? [yes|no]
[no] yes
4.安装成功
For this change to become active, you have to open a new terminal.
Thank you for installing Anaconda2!
Share your notebooks and packages on Anaconda Cloud!
Sign up for free:
5.让.bashrc中添加的路径生效:
source ~/.bashrc
如何在ubuntu下安装opencv2
1. 下载OpenCV 2.2源码包, 2.2.0.tar.bz2,其实可以通过apt-get install命令找到opencv相关包直接安装,但是建议从源码包MAKE,编译开始。
2. 安装cmake. OpenCV官方论坛的安装教程,我看了下,貌似不适用于2.2版本了,2.2源码解压后得到文件夹OpenCV-2.2.0后,里面有个文件叫CMakeList.txt,这是cmake的"makefile",通过这个文件,cmake先把源码配置成常规安装包,生成gcc的make的Makefile文件。
好了,首先,在与源码包同级的目录下新建一个文件夹OpenCV-build,然后安装cmake。终端下sudo apt-get install cmake,然后sudo apt-get install cmake-qt-gui,两个安装成功后,终端输入cmake-gui,会打开一个界面:
点击Browse Source选择刚才解压的源码文件夹,再点击Browse Build选择刚才新建的OpenCV-build文件夹,点击configure按钮,这时Generate按钮应该已经可以点击了,不过Generate按钮还是灰色,再点一次configure按钮试试,应该就可以了,点击Generate按钮之后,可以看到下方有提示成功。
3. 打开OpenCV-build文件夹,里面已经出现了Makefile文件,像这样:
打开终端, 转到OpenCV-build下,输入make,应该就会出现这么一连串犀利的安装过程了...